修复酶基因多态性与食管癌发生危险性的关系
Relationship between polymorphisms of DNA repair genes and esophageal cancer risk

【摘要】 [目的] 研究DNA修复基因XPA(A23G)、XPD(Lys751Gln)、XRCC1(Arg194Trp和Arg399Gln)多态性与食管癌易感性的关系。[方法] 通过1:1配对的病例-对照研究研究方法收集样本106对,应用PCR-RFLP技术检测样本的基因型,比较不同基因型与食管癌易感性的关系。[结果]携带XPA G/G基因型的个体与携带A/A基因型者相比,可降低患食管癌的危险性(OR=0.4737,95%CI=0.2280-0.9839);食管癌组中,携带XRCC1 399(Gln/Gln)的个体数高于对照组,其患食管癌的危险性是对照人群的3倍(OR=3.447,95%CI=1.078-11.026,P=0.029)。含有XPD 751 Gln、XRCC1194Trp等位基因的个体其患食管癌的易感性未见显著性升高(OR=1.424,95%CI=0.621-3.263;OR=0.826,95%CI=0.857-1.381)。[结论]DNA修复基因XPA 23位和XRCC1 399位多态可能在食管癌的发生中起一定作用。
【Abstract】 [Objective] To explore the relationship between the polymorphisms of XPA (A23G), XPD (Lys751Gln), XRCC1 (Arg194Trp and Arg399Gln) genotypes and susceptibility to esophageal cancer in Huai’an population, China. [Methods] A 1:1 case-control study was conducted among 106 ESCC patients and 106 control subjects (matched by age±5 years and gender). PCR-RLFP method was used to detect genotypes. [Results] There was significant difference of distribution of mutant homozygote of XPA 23 and XRCC1 399 genotype between cases and controls (X2=4.0277,P=0.0448; X2=4.745, P=0.029, respectively). Individuals with mutant allele of XPD 751 or XRCC1 194 genotype do not show the rising risk of esophageal cancer (OR=1.424, 95%CI=0.621-3.263; OR=0.826, 95%CI=0.857-1.381, respectively). [Conclusion] The results showed that the polymorphisms of XPA A23G and XRCC1 Arg399Gln were related to the susceptibility of esophageal cancer.
